Sigüenza
Sigüenza is foremost a city in Spain famous for its "casa de los obispos" and "el doncel", whose sepulture in the cathedral is one of the jewel of Spanish gothic style. It is also a Municipio. We visited the city itself (staying at the parador) and the municipality on 12-14 March (2016).
